Perry Announces ‘Blue Alert’ Program To Catch Fugitives
AUSTIN (AP) – A plan announced today by Governor Rick Perry is meant to help find criminals who flee after killing or seriously hurting a law officer.
Perry says the “Blue Alert” Network will help authorities locate fugitives after officers are attacked in the line of duty.
The Blue Alert project involves the Texas Department of Public Safety, the Governor’s Division of Emergency Management and the Department of Transportation.
An offender’s vehicle information will be displayed across the state via TxDOT highway message signs and media broadcasts.
The Blue Alert program is similar to the Amber Alert program to help find missing and abducted children, and Silver Alerts for missing senior citizens.
